Kerala Recipes

Kerala cuisine reflects the lush tropical landscape and historic spice trade of India's southwestern Malabar Coast. Coconut in every form — milk, oil, grated, and toddy — is the defining ingredient, alongside curry leaves, black pepper, and tamarind. The cuisine encompasses diverse traditions from Hindu, Christian, and Muslim communities, producing dishes like appam with stew, fish moilee, avial, and the elaborate Sadya banana leaf feast. Kerala's position as the origin of the global spice trade profoundly shaped its culinary identity.
